Serbia, Bulgaria pledge to boost partnership

Initiation of Serbia’s EU accession talks opens new possibilities for comprehensive deepening of the partnership between Serbia and Bulgaria.

During his official visit to Bulgaria, Mrkić had separate high-level meetings with the Bulgarian president, prime minister, parliament speaker and foreign minister.

Plevneliev said that Bulgaria and Serbia need to build relations based on mutual understanding and development of the vision which reflects their mutual future in the EU, Bulgarian News Agency (BTA) reported.

The meeting also covered the activities of the Bulgarian-Serbian Chamber of Commerce and Industry set up in 2013 and the idea for staging a joint business forum which would gather representatives of the two countries in the border area in Serbia which is home to Bulgarian national minority.

Mrkić extended assurances to Plevneliev that Serbia would do all it needs to do to improve the life of Bulgarian national minority in Serbia.
